Python Developer

5 - 8 years

15 - 30 Lacs

Pune, Bengaluru

Posted:3 months ago| Platform: Naukri logo

Apply

Skills Required

Tkinter Desktop Application Development Python Development API Python Microservices SQL

Work Mode

Hybrid

Job Type

Full Time

Job Description

Job Title: Python Developer Job Overview: We are seeking a highly skilled and motivated Python Developer with expertise in CI/CD, unit test cases, deployment, Tkinter, SQL models for app integration, Python desktop applications, Retool, Flask, and web applications. The ideal candidate will have hands-on experience in developing and maintaining robust applications, ensuring seamless integration and deployment processes. Key Responsibilities: Develop and Maintain Applications: Design, develop, and maintain Python desktop applications using Tkinter and web applications using Flask. CI/CD Implementation: Implement and manage CI/CD pipelines to automate the build, test, and deployment processes. Unit Testing: Write and maintain unit test cases to ensure code quality and reliability. SQL Integration: Develop and manage SQL models for seamless app integration. Deployment: Oversee the deployment of applications, ensuring smooth and efficient rollouts. Retool Integration: Utilize Retool for building internal tools and applications. Web Development: Develop and maintain web applications using Flask. Collaboration: Work closely with cross-functional teams to gather requirements and deliver high-quality software solutions. Required Skills: Python Proficiency: Strong experience in Python programming. CI/CD Tools: Hands-on experience with CI/CD tools such as Jenkins, GitLab CI, or CircleCI. Unit Testing: Proficiency in writing unit test cases using frameworks like unittest or pytest. Tkinter: Experience in developing desktop applications using Tkinter. Flask: Experience in developing web applications using Flask. Retool: Experience with Retool for building internal tools. SQL: Advanced knowledge of SQL and experience with SQL models for app integration. Deployment: Experience with deployment processes and tools. Problem-Solving: Strong analytical and problem-solving skills. Collaboration: Excellent communication and teamwork abilities. Qualifications: Education: Bachelors or Masters degree in Computer Science, Information Technology, or related fields. Experience: 5-8 years of professional experience in Python development, with a focus on CI/CD, unit testing, deployment, desktop applications, and web applications.

Mock Interview

Practice Video Interview with JobPe AI

Start Tkinter Interview Now
SG Analytics
SG Analytics

Business Consulting and Services

New York New York

1001-5000 Employees

24 Jobs

    Key People

  • Sandeep Ghosh

    Co-Founder & CEO
  • Pooja Kumar

    Co-Founder & COO

RecommendedJobs for You